Wrong Turn 3: Left for Dead (2009) is the third installment in the horror franchise, focusing on a group of convicts and a prison guard who must survive a cannibalistic attack after their transport bus crashes in the West Virginia woods. Movie Overview Plot Summary

: The story begins with a group of friends rafting in the woods who are killed by the cannibalistic Three Finger. Later, a bus transporting dangerous convicts crashes after its tires are blown out. The survivors—convicts and guards—must navigate the forest while being hunted by the mutant cannibals. Key Characters Three Finger

What is Wrong Turn 3: Left for Dead?

Released direct-to-video in 2009, Wrong Turn 3: Left for Dead ditches the slow-burn tension of the first film for pure, relentless action. Directed by Declan O'Brien, the plot follows a group of prison transport officers and convicts who crash their bus deep in the backwoods of West Virginia. Their problem? They’ve crashed on the hunting grounds of Three Finger (the iconic cannibal) and his inbred family.

Unlike the second film, which focused on a reality TV crew, Part 3 introduces a "survival of the fittest" dynamic. The lines blur between good and evil as a ruthless convict (Chavez, played by Tamer Hassan) teams up with a desperate cop (Nate, played by Tom McKay) to outrun the monsters.
